Eggedal is a village in the municipality of Sigdal in Viken county, Norway. It is located in the traditional region of Buskerud. The village is situated at the northern end of the Eggedal valley, about 20 kilometres (12 mi) northwest of the town of Hønefoss. Eggedal has a population of about 500 people.

Best time to go
The best time to visit Eggedal is during the summer months (June-August), when the weather is warm and sunny. However, Eggedal is also a beautiful place to visit in the winter months (December-March), when the snow-covered landscapes are stunning.
What to Eat
Eggedal is home to a number of restaurants that serve traditional Norwegian cuisine. Some of the most popular dishes include:
- Fårikål: A lamb stew made with cabbage and potatoes.
- Rømmegrøt: A porridge made with sour cream and flour.
- Vafler: A type of waffle that is often served with jam and cream.
